The left ticket the air was 1814ft The right ticket(AED) the air was 2364ft


I had a tune from a pretty well known place and I didn't think it was running or shifting right. So I got a tune from AED, car drove better on the street. Took it to the track with the only thing changed was the tune and I didn't have skinnies on the AED tune run (had street tires front, ET streets rear for both runs) The car was pretty heat soaked only have 30 min cool down from driving it there.



looks like corrected 7.40 1/8mi [email protected] .. I need some good air lol

Car has installed right now

4200 Circle D
ORX
JLT Cai
3:55 gears
Zero weight reduction



There was nothing done to make the car 60ft better. It was lazy with the other tune off the line. I didn't want to load the other tune back in the car to test, it drove like shit and was slower.


The car went 12.81 stock the air was 715ft
